The dots are only about 4 nanometers in diameter, but they are encapsulated in biocompatible microparticles that form spheres about 20 microns in diameter. Tests using human cadaver skin showed that the quantum-dot patterns could be detected by smartphone cameras after up to five years of simulated sun exposure. The researchers now plan to survey health care workers in developing nations in Africa to get input on the best way to implement this type of vaccination record keeping. 0000234977 00000 n As the authors wrote, outbreaks of measles and mumps in the United States, Australia, and Italy have highlighted that poor immunization recordkeeping is not unique to developing nations. Without accurate vaccination records, they pointed out, healthcare professionals dont have all the data they need to make informed decisions about administering vaccines, and they may have to rely on parental recall.
